Attorney Servet Yildiz Stêrk recently participated in a conversation with Prime Minister Jonas Gahr Støre and Minister of Labour and Inclusion Tonje Brenna on combating racism in Norway. The discussion took place at the Deichman Library in Oslo in conjunction with the government's launch of an action plan featuring 50 measures against racism and discrimination.
During the event, held on November 23, 2023, the Prime Minister initiated the dialogue with the question: "Can you tell me a time you experienced racism?" This prompted a discussion on racism and discrimination in Norwegian society.
According to the government, racism and discrimination remain issues in Norway, forming the basis for the new action plan. The measures are to be implemented across various sectors of society to counteract discrimination.
The conversation between Attorney Stêrk and the government representatives was part of the launch event, where personal experiences with racism were highlighted as part of efforts to raise awareness of the issue.
